Welcome to The Cottage at Pine Grove, a charming escape nestled in the woods where peace and nostalgia meet. This sweet 125-year-old blue Victorian cottage, with its cheerful yellow door and timeless craftsmanship, offers the perfect retreat from everyday life. Inside, you’ll find a cozy one-bedroom haven with a plush King bed, a snug "Bed Nook" with another King, and a daybed in the sunroom—accommodating up to four guests.
Relax in the serene sunroom, a perfect spot for your morning coffee or a good book. Step outside and enjoy nature with Adirondack chairs, al fresco dining, or a barbecue on the propane grill. Drift into relaxation on the hammock or unwind in the hot tub, tucked quietly behind the cottage.
In the evening, gather around the pellet stove for warmth and conversation, or indulge in entertainment with Roku TVs in both the living room and bedroom. For a touch of nostalgia, enjoy the record player, board games, puzzles, and books. There’s even a workspace in the living room for those who need to catch up on work or jot down thoughts.
Located in Historic Pine Grove, a quaint railroad town, the cottage is just a short walk from the Pine Library, Antique Emporium, and Zoka’s restaurant. Sphinx Park and the Bucksnort Saloon are nearby, or take a quick drive to Pine Valley Ranch Park for hiking, fishing, and biking. Just 40 minutes to Red Rocks and an hour from downtown Denver, it’s the perfect spot to explore and relax.
Please note, the Cottage is full of character. Doors require a special pull or push, and each heater has its own thermostat. The vintage kitchen is without a dishwasher, and the stove is slightly smaller than modern standards. The original wood-burning stove, stamped 1896, serves as a unique breakfast bar. Pets and children are welcome, but be mindful of antique furnishings and the original glass windows.
Embrace the challenges of mountain living—wildlife, snowstorms, and steep dirt roads. AWD vehicles are recommended, especially in winter, but most cars can manage with the provided directions. While cell service is limited, Wi-Fi calling works great.
